Cognitive Behavioral (CBT)
I believe that your thoughts and emotions deeply effect how you behave on a daily basis. When we change and challenge your irrational thoughts then we can change your behaviors.
Trauma Informed Care
It's very important to me when a client has gone through trauma, as many of as many have, to be sensitive. I don't believe in making clients tell their trauma story, but rather address how their trauma is affecting them in this moment.
